Chili (Italian Sausage and Bell Peppers)

slowcookerbeefitaliansausagechiliItalian sausage chili is a hearty twist on classic chili, combining savoury Italian flavours like oregano and sometimes basil or fennel seeds with traditional chili spices, beans and tomatoes. It is often made with a mix of mild and hot Italian sausage and sometimes ground beef, to layer the flavour profile.

2 Tbsp. extra-virgin olive oil
2 green bell peppers, seeded, diced
1 large onion, diced
2 lbs hot Italian sausages, casings removed
¼ cup tomato paste
2 (15.5 oz) cans cannellini beans, drained and rinsed
1 (28 oz) can diced tomatoes, not drained
2 tsp. garlic powder
2 tsp. chili powder
1½ tsp. sea salt

In a large Dutch oven or heavy-bottomed pot heat olive oil over high heat until shimmering. Stir in peppers and onion until well coated in oil. Cook, stirring occasionally, over high heat until peppers and onions begin to char, about 8 minutes.

Add sausage meat. Cook, stirring occasionally and breaking into crumbles, until just cooked through, about 8 minutes.

Push sausage and vegetables to the side of pot. There will be a bit of fat revealed. Add tomato paste to that fat and then spread it into a flat layer. Cook, without stirring to caramelize it for about 1 minute.

Stir tomato paste into sausage mixture. Let cook undisturbed for 5 minutes. Stir to incorporate any caramelized bits on the bottom of the pot. Let cook undisturbed for 5 minutes more.

Stir in beans, tomatoes, garlic powder, chili powder and salt. Reduce to a simmer. Cook, stirring occasionally, for 10 minutes.

Spoon into bowls and serve.
